We discuss off-shell contributions in Higgs decays to heavy gauge bosons
HβVV(β) with Vβ{Z,W} for a standard model (SM)
Higgs boson for both dominant production processes e+eββZHβZVV(β) and e+eββΞ½Ξ½ΛHβΞ½Ξ½ΛVV(β) at a (linear) e+eβ collider. Dependent on the
centre-of-mass energy off-shell effects are sizable and important for the
understanding of the electroweak symmetry breaking mechanism. Moreover we
shortly investigate the effects of the signal-background interference in
HβΞ³Ξ³ decays for the Higgsstrahlung initiated process
e+eββZΞ³Ξ³, where we report a similar shift in the
invariant mass peak of the two photons as found for the LHC. For both effects
we discuss the sensitivity to the total Higgs width.Comment: 11 pages, 9 figures, talk presented at the International Workshop on
